WebbRadial club hand refers to a condition in which the radial (referring to the radius, the smaller bone of the forearm) or thumb-side of the arm is malformed, causing a shortening and … WebbPolydactyly is the presence of one or more extra fingers on the hand. An extra finger may be small and nonfunctional — made of only skin and soft tissue — or may be fully formed with bones of its own.
